Transaction 889e7dedb5c204fbdb61c76268b8fa123c7325b79b95ef3ced7b11bf8409229e
1 Input
1 Output
-
889e7dedb5c204fbdb61c76268b8fa123c7325b79b95ef3ced7b11bf8409229e:0
- value
- 23328270
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23d733d5960dbcddb75c9f8904bfe66afdb41ee5 OP_EQUAL
- address
- MBAfgg5RqTp2pj984PLTmXW2RBRDmFcrWH